Active filters amplify desired signals while rejecting unwanted frequencies, and can be tailored to meet application-specific requirements in electronics.
Amplifiers boost signal strength, match impedance levels, and are essential in many circuit systems, including audio, broadcasting, and telecommunications.
Batteries store and provide electrical energy, come in various types and sizes for multiple uses, rechargeable or single-use.
Capacitors store electrical charge with metallic plates and a dielectric; types vary and can be combined for specific circuit characteristics.
Chip carriers and sockets provide an interface between components and PCBs, enabling easy replacement or upgrading without soldering.
Circuit protection devices prevent damage from overcurrent flow, including fuses, breakers, surge protectors, and voltage regulators.
Connector accessories and support devices aid connector function and longevity, including backshells, grips, clamps, and ties; must be compatible with connector type.
Connectors join electronic circuits to transfer signals and power, come in various sizes and shapes, and include support accessories.
Converters transform DC input to another voltage level, essential in electronic systems, renewable energy, and automotive electronics.
Crystals and resonators generate and stabilize frequency signals via piezoelectricity. They are used in timing, frequency control, and filters. Crystals are quartz and resonators are ceramic with a built-in capacitor.
Semiconductor diodes control current flow in one direction (uni-directionality) via low resistance. Useful for rectification, voltage regulation, detection, and digital logic.

Fiber optics use light pulses to transmit data over long distances. They have superior bandwidth capacity, low signal attenuation, and secure physical properties. They are essential in telecommunications networks today.
Filters enhance signal processing by selectively passing desired frequencies while suppressing unwanted ones. Filters can be passive (using capacitors, resistors, and inductors) or active (using transistors or amplifiers).

Molex LLC is a manufacturer of electronic, electrical, and fiber optic connectivity systems. Molex offers over 100,000 products across a variety of industries, including data communications, medical, industrial, automotive and consumer electronics. They are notable for pioneering the Molex connector, which has seen universal adoption in personal computing. The company is considered the second largest electronic connector company in the world. Molex was established in 1938 by Frederick Krehbiel. The company began by making flowerpots out of an industrial byproduct plastic called Molex. Krehbiel developed this material by combining asbestos tailings, coal tar pitch, and limestone. Aside from flower pots, Molex also sold salt shakers before it expanded into electrical connectors and sensors.Later they made connectors for General Electric and other appliance manufacturers out of the same plastic. Molex acquired Woodhead Industries in 2006; the largest acquisition in the former's history at the time.
